返回php的依赖注......登陆

php的依赖注入

峰回2019-04-17 16:16:41147
<?php
class A
{
  public function hello(){
    echo 'hello';
  }
}

class B
{
  public function sayHello(){
    $a = new A();
    $a->hello();
  }
}

class C
{
  // 依赖注入的用法
  public function sayHello(A $a){
    $a->hello();
  }
}

//这样对吗?在一个控制器里面有很多的类abc ,然后c想用a类里面的对象然后用依赖注入。理解是这样但是在实际的例子中不知道该如何使用

最新手记推荐

• 用composer安装thinkphp框架的步骤• 省市区接口说明• 用thinkphp,后台新增栏目• 管理员添加编辑删除• 管理员添加编辑删除

全部回复(0)我要回复

暂无评论~
  • 取消回复发送